## Deployment

The consent banner (project Lanterngate) ships behind the `banner_rollout` flag. Deploy to staging first, verify the banner renders on the Quillmont and Ardessa test tenants, then promote. Rollout proceeds in 10% increments per region; the release manager gates each step. Translations are bundled, so no separate asset push is needed. Before promoting, confirm the environment carries the following configuration values.

settings of kagag-kagef:
[kelath]
port = 9300
region = west-4
host = kelath.olvarqworks.example
team = sorion
timeout_ms = 1000
retries = 8

Subject: Quick heads-up — Tervold supply contract

Hi all,

The Tervold renewal is nearly done — we got the volume rebate bumped and locked pricing for two years, which should take some pressure off the materials line. Finance folks, please model the new terms into next quarter's forecast before Friday's review. One open item: payment terms shift to sixty days, so watch the cash timing. More context on where this is heading below.

internal memo for hahaf-kahof: Only 39 of the 428 pilot accounts renewed Sorion, so a churn review is set for April 12. Praokix Freight is in early talks to buy Queniusox Group for about $145.8 million.

## Changelog — Schemavane 4.2.0

Changed defaults for the event schema registry. Compatibility mode now defaults to BACKWARD instead of NONE, so producers registering breaking changes will be rejected unless they opt out. Default schema cache TTL dropped from 24h to 1h, and anonymous reads are now disabled by default. Support: expect tickets from teams whose pipelines relied on NONE mode — point them to the override flag. New installs pick up these defaults automatically; the full default configuration now shipped is as follows.

deployment values, yadug-bawif:
[framir]
team = pelox
access_code = ac_a38ab2
owner = tamion.julael
host = framir.tolvaqlabs.test
port = 11211
peer = tammir.zemvargrid.local
salt = 2215ef03
pin = 1541

Subject: Date localization rollout — Brightmere 4.2

Hi all — the locale-aware date formatting patch is ready for the release branch. It swaps our hardcoded month-day ordering for per-region patterns and covers all twelve supported locales, with fallbacks verified in staging. No schema changes are involved. Please gate the promotion on the signed artifact, which you can confirm using the build token below.

trace token, kawip-fafog: htk14_26e64c4d35154e